I've ordered my diamond so it's crunch time on deciding which metal I want for my band.
I've decided on this band:
http://www.gabrielny.com/engaged/style/ER5651W44JJ
The design is intricate so I was considering platinum. The sales rep at ID Jewelry is suggesting white gold instead for a detailed design and that it would wear better than platinum. I enquired about the rhodium plating and she said every 5 years at the most. Gabriel only offers a white gold alloy mixed with nickel (I would have preferred white gold with palladium).
The quoted prices from ID Jewelry are $995 for 14k white gold, $1500 for platinum, or $850 in palladium. The rep said all three metals look basically the same.
Based on the design, which metal would be recommended? I want the intricate detail and small diamonds to be secure.
